Minority Report(ed) (2 of 3)Foreignness was also used as the butt of a joke for the audience when we find out that the replacement eyes Tom Cruise received in order to avoid retinal recognition turned out to belong to a Mr. Yakamoto. If Tom Cruise were called Mr. Spielberg, it would be a miserable attempt at humor. But it is just so funny that Tom Cruise has the eyes of a Japanese man who, of course, stereotypically exemplifies the ultimate level of foreignness and non-whiteness that just cannot be taken seriously. Somehow, the thought of Tom Cruise having the eyes of an Asian man is just too incongruous with his hot boy image. Hot Asian men? What an oxymoron. “Minority Report” fares no better in terms of gender. Although conceding that “the female one” is obviously more talented than the two male pre-cogs, this is meant as a joke at the expense of woman, evidenced by the whole theater bursting out in laughter. Perhaps this is merely a joke without undertones, but oppressed peoples have always been victimized through jokes, as this tactic absolves the perpetrator of any serious responsibilities. No doubt Spielberg was perfectly aware of the effect that he was going for. This is followed by another collective sexist outburst the audience exhibits when the older woman who invented the Precrime program kissed Tom Cruise on the lips. Obviously it is all right (even envied) for old men to kiss younger women (along with a score of other things) in movies and real life, but an old woman exhibiting her sexuality (with a younger man too!) must be a joke. Oh please. Also, couldn’t Tom Cruise have picked one of the male pre-cogs to help him (oh yeah, the female one was the only one that can help him, how convenient)? The incredibly long scene where Mr. Cruise carried the weak and helpless female pre-cog on his side is probably a warning to women that no matter how smart they are, they still need a man to take care of them. Of course a big reason the audience remained enthralled in the scene was because of the potential of something happening between the two—an example of Spielberg superbly utilizing the heterosexism of his audience. Wouldn’t it have been nice to see Tom Cruise getting it on with one of the male pre-cogs, carrying him in his arms and eventually making out with him in the hotel room?
